Macrodactylus fulvescens
Macrodactylus fulvescens
Description
Systematic position and general characteristics
Macrodactylus fulvescens belongs to the order Coleoptera and the family Scarabaeidae. This species is a member of the chafer beetle group, often recognized for its slender, elongated body and long legs, which are typical for the genus. While often overshadowed by its relative, the rose chafer (Macrodactylus subspinosus), it is nonetheless a significant pest in various regions, capable of causing localized but severe damage to diverse vegetation.
Host crops and affected plants
The beetle is a polyphagous pest, feeding on a wide variety of plant species. It is particularly damaging to ornamental plants like roses, as well as several tree fruits and grapevines. It also frequently attacks agricultural crops, including corn, when environmental conditions favor the rapid population growth of the insect. The adults show a strong preference for tender plant tissues, including flower buds and young foliage.
Biology and life cycle
The life cycle involves four distinct stages: egg, larva, pupa, and adult. The larval stage develops entirely within the soil, where they consume root systems and organic matter. After pupation in the soil, the adults emerge to feed on above-ground plant parts. The synchronization of adult emergence with the flowering period of major crops makes this pest particularly problematic for commercial growers and home gardeners alike.
Damage and economic impact
The primary damage is caused by adult beetles, which skeletonize leaves and consume flowers and developing fruit. Severe infestations can lead to complete defoliation of host plants, significantly reducing the plant's ability to undergo photosynthesis and store energy. For flowering shrubs and fruit-bearing trees, the aesthetic and commercial losses can be substantial, often requiring immediate intervention to prevent long-term damage to plant health.
Control and management strategies
Effective management requires a combination of cultural, mechanical, and chemical tactics:
- Soil cultivation to disrupt larval development and reduce population density.
- Manual collection of beetles in small-scale plantings during the early morning hours.
- Installation of physical barriers or netting for highly susceptible plants.
- Application of selective insecticides when monitoring indicates populations exceeding economic thresholds.
Integrated Pest Management (IPM) practices are highly recommended to balance the need for control with environmental safety, focusing on monitoring and threshold-based treatments.
